[XAU/USD] Amid Thanksgiving in the US

With Israel and Hezbollah reaching a ceasefire agreement, geopolitical risks have temporarily eased. However, the drop in long-term US interest rates has increased demand for gold. Today is Thanksgiving in the US, meaning there will be fewer market participants, and a quiet market is expected. However, because market liquidity will be low, even small news or events could cause significant price movements in one direction. If there is a reaction, the focus might be on the possibility of prices rising due to filling the gap from the sharp decline on the 25th.
